About Us

At Autoglass and Laddaw , m aking a difference is what our business is all about. For 40 years we’ve maintained our position as the UK’s favourite vehicle glass specialist, fitting safety as standard for millions of customers each year. Our people are innovative, collaborative and customer-focused – together, we support each other to achieve real excellence in everything we do.

Since 1972, Autoglass has been proud to provide mobile vehicle glass services to UK customers, and over the years we’ve become a household name and national superbrand. In 1982, we became part of the world’s largest vehicle glass replacement business upon joining Belron Group . In 1990, Autoglass revolutionised the vehicle glass industry by introducing the first ever vehicle glass repair service (Glass Medic), thanks to a technical innovation introduced by Belron.

Established in 1975, Laddaw is our wholesale glass business. Our customer’s ever-changing requirements are the driving force behind the development of all our products, technologies and support services. Through our purpose-built distribution centre, we offer our customers access to a great range of products.
